The SSTUG32865ET/S,518 is a high-performance, registered clock driver (RCD) designed and manufactured by NXP Semiconductors. This innovative component is tailored to meet the stringent demands of server memory systems and high-speed computing applications. It serves as a critical part of memory buffer registers in DDR2, DDR3, and DDR4 SDRAM modules, ensuring signal integrity and timing precision.
